A Windom man sought medical care for gunshot wounds last week, two days after being shot while hunting in Jackson County.

Kyle Miller, 19, was struck with pellets while hunting pheasants south of Windom on Oct. 13.

Miller told sheriff’s deputies he was walking up a small hill with other members of his hunting group down below when pheasants flew into the air and the group below fired. Pellets from the gunfire struck Miller.
